Riley in the Bible
The name Riley does not appear in the Bible as it is a relatively modern English name. However, the meaning of names in the Bible is often significant and carries deep symbolism. Names in the Bible were not merely labels but were believed to convey the essence or destiny of the individual. In this sense, we can explore the meaning of the name Riley in a biblical context.

Riley Meaning and Origin
The name Riley is of Old English origin, derived from the words “ryge,” meaning rye, and “leah,” meaning clearing or meadow. Therefore, Riley originally meant “rye clearing” or “rye meadow.” In the Bible, fields and meadows are often symbolic of abundance, growth, and provision. They represent places of sustenance where God’s people are fed and nurtured.
